Short set of two Playford tunes by Rackett's Olde English live from Langenhoe in Essex, England. Olde English are a folk-rock band, part of Rackett's Companie of Musick, celebrating the sounds and customs of 17th century England. They play on a blend of authentic instruments (cittern, gittern, violin, viol, recorder, bagpipe) and modern (drums, sax) to bring Restoration street music to modern audiences.
